:quality(75)/ifc_6_82dfb254ed.png)
Định dạng file IFC là gì? Tìm hiểu vai trò và ứng dụng của file IFC trong lĩnh vực xây dựng
Bạn có bao giờ thắc mắc file IFC là gì và vì sao các dự án xây dựng đều sử dụng nó? Đây là định dạng tiêu chuẩn giúp trao đổi dữ liệu BIM giữa các phần mềm, đảm bảo thông tin thiết kế, kết cấu và vật liệu được chia sẻ chính xác, đồng bộ, nâng cao hiệu quả quản lý công trình. Hãy cùng FPT Shop tìm hiểu chi tiết về vai trò thực tế của file IFC.
File IFC là gì?
IFC là viết tắt của Industry Foundation Classes, một định dạng dữ liệu tiêu chuẩn quốc tế được phát triển bởi buildingSMART International. File IFC được thiết kế nhằm trao đổi dữ liệu mô hình giữa các phần mềm khác nhau như Revit, ArchiCAD, Tekla, Navisworks, hay Vectorworks.
Nói đơn giản, file IFC là “ngôn ngữ chung” trong BIM. Nó giúp các ứng dụng hiểu và sử dụng dữ liệu mô hình mà không phụ thuộc vào định dạng riêng của từng hãng. Một file IFC thường có phần mở rộng là .ifc, .ifcZIP hoặc .ifcXML, tùy theo dạng nén dữ liệu và chứa toàn bộ thông tin 3D, thuộc tính kỹ thuật, vật liệu, kích thước và mối quan hệ giữa các thành phần công trình.

Định dạng IFC được phát triển từ những năm 1990 bởi tổ chức buildingSMART (trước đây gọi là IAI - International Alliance for Interoperability). Mục tiêu của IFC là xây dựng một tiêu chuẩn mở, không bị ràng buộc bởi bất kỳ nhà cung cấp phần mềm nào, nhằm thúc đẩy khả năng tương tác (interoperability) trong ngành xây dựng.
IFC ngày càng hoàn thiện hơn với một số phiên bản phổ biến hiện nay gồm:
- IFC2x3: Được sử dụng rộng rãi nhất trong thực tế, tương thích tốt với nhiều phần mềm BIM.
- IFC4: Phiên bản mới hơn, cải thiện khả năng mô tả chi tiết và hỗ trợ dữ liệu phong phú hơn.
Cấu trúc dữ liệu của file IFC
File IFC được xây dựng theo cấu trúc đối tượng (object-based), tức mỗi thành phần trong công trình được thể hiện như một object có thuộc tính riêng. Mỗi yếu tố trong công trình (như tường, cửa, sàn, cột, ống nước, thiết bị điện,…) được coi là một đối tượng IFC (IFC Object) có thuộc tính và mối quan hệ riêng. Cấu trúc của file IFC bao gồm:
- IfcProject - Dự án tổng thể.
- IfcSite - Khu đất, vị trí xây dựng.
- IfcBuilding - Công trình hoặc tòa nhà.
- IfcBuildingStorey - Các tầng của công trình.
- IfcElement - Các thành phần chi tiết như tường (IfcWall), cửa (IfcDoor), cửa sổ (IfcWindow), cầu thang (IfcStair)…

Nhờ cấu trúc này, dữ liệu trong IFC có thể được tách, sửa đổi, hoặc liên kết linh hoạt, giúp việc quản lý và cập nhật mô hình dễ dàng hơn. Một số phần mềm BIM hiện nay có khả năng xuất - nhập (export/import) file IFC hiệu quả gồm Autodesk Revit, Graphisoft ArchiCAD, Tekla Structures, Allplan, Bentley MicroStation, Vectorworks, Navisworks, Solibri Office và BIMVision (miễn phí). Ngoài ra, nhiều nền tảng quản lý mô hình trực tuyến như BIM collab, Trimble Connect, hay Autodesk Construction Cloud cũng hỗ trợ hiển thị file IFC trực tiếp trên trình duyệt.
Ưu nhược điểm của định dạng file IFC
Ưu điểm
- Tính mở và khả năng tương thích cao: Không giống như các định dạng độc quyền (như RVT của Revit hay PLN của ArchiCAD), IFC là định dạng mở, có thể sử dụng trên nhiều nền tảng khác nhau mà không phụ thuộc vào nhà phát triển ứng dụng.
- Dễ dàng chia sẻ dữ liệu: Khi một kỹ sư kết cấu dùng Tekla và một kiến trúc sư dùng Revit, họ vẫn có thể trao đổi mô hình dễ dàng thông qua file IFC. Điều này giúp các nhóm dự án phối hợp hiệu quả hơn, giảm sai sót trong thiết kế và thi công.
- Lưu trữ thông tin toàn diện: File IFC không chỉ lưu hình học 3D mà còn bao gồm thông tin phi hình học như vật liệu, khối lượng, nhà sản xuất, mã thiết bị, thông số kỹ thuật,... Nhờ vậy, nó có thể được sử dụng xuyên suốt vòng đời công trình từ thiết kế, thi công đến vận hành và bảo trì.
- Đảm bảo tính bền vững và lâu dài: Do là tiêu chuẩn quốc tế được ISO công nhận (ISO 16739), IFC có tính ổn định và lâu dài, giúp dữ liệu BIM không bị lỗi thời khi phần mềm thay đổi.

Nhược điểm
- Không truyền tải 100% dữ liệu gốc: Một số thông tin đặc thù của phần mềm gốc (như tham số động, constraint, hoặc family trong Revit) có thể bị mất khi xuất sang IFC.
- Dung lượng lớn: File IFC chứa nhiều thông tin nên thường có kích thước lớn, gây tốn dung lượng lưu trữ và thời gian xử lý.
- Phụ thuộc vào trình đọc (IFC Viewer): Người dùng cần phần mềm hỗ trợ để xem và kiểm tra mô hình IFC, ví dụ Solibri Model Viewer, BIMVision, Tekla BIMsight hoặc Autodesk Navisworks.
Ứng dụng thực tế của file IFC trong ngành xây dựng
Trong thiết kế kiến trúc
- Chia sẻ mô hình 3D giữa các phần mềm khác nhau: File IFC cho phép kiến trúc sư xuất mô hình từ Revit, ArchiCAD hay Tekla và gửi sang kỹ sư kết cấu, kỹ sư MEP mà vẫn giữ nguyên thông tin về hình dạng, kích thước và vị trí.
- Phát hiện xung đột thiết kế (Clash Detection): Sử dụng phần mềm như Navisworks hay Solibri, các mô hình IFC từ nhiều bên có thể được kiểm tra để phát hiện xung đột giữa hệ thống điện, nước, điều hòa và kết cấu, giúp giảm sai sót và chi phí sửa chữa sau này.
- Tối ưu hóa thiết kế: Các thông số trong IFC giúp các kiến trúc sư và kỹ sư dễ dàng phân tích, điều chỉnh bố trí phòng, kết cấu, ánh sáng, thông gió,… ngay trong giai đoạn thiết kế.

Trong quản lý thi công
- Quản lý tiến độ và vật tư: File IFC lưu trữ thông tin chi tiết về vật liệu, khối lượng và vị trí lắp đặt. Điều này hỗ trợ nhà thầu theo dõi tiến độ thi công, lập dự toán vật liệu và tránh lãng phí.
- Hỗ trợ thi công ảo: Mô hình IFC có thể được tích hợp vào phần mềm mô phỏng thi công, giúp kỹ sư và công nhân nhìn trước cách lắp đặt, giảm rủi ro trên công trường.
- Phối hợp đa bên: Trong các dự án lớn, nhiều nhà thầu tham gia cùng lúc. IFC giúp tất cả các bên làm việc trên cùng một dữ liệu, hạn chế nhầm lẫn và tăng hiệu quả phối hợp.
Trong vận hành và bảo trì công trình
- Quản lý tài sản và bảo trì: Các thông số kỹ thuật, thông tin bảo hành, hướng dẫn vận hành của thiết bị đều có thể lưu trong file IFC. Chủ đầu tư và quản lý tòa nhà dễ dàng truy cập thông tin khi bảo trì hoặc nâng cấp hệ thống.
- Tích hợp với IoT và quản lý năng lượng: IFC giúp kết nối mô hình BIM với các thiết bị cảm biến, hệ thống giám sát năng lượng, từ đó tối ưu hóa chi phí vận hành và bảo trì công trình.
Bên cạnh đó, file IFC còn được ứng dụng trong kiểm soát chất lượng và an toàn xây dựng, như mô phỏng lối thoát hiểm, kiểm tra tiêu chuẩn PCCC, hay đánh giá rủi ro thi công. Nhờ mô hình IFC, các kỹ sư có thể đưa ra giải pháp an toàn trước khi triển khai thực tế, giảm thiểu tai nạn và đảm bảo tuân thủ quy chuẩn kỹ thuật.

Tạm kết
Việc hiểu rõ file IFC là gì và ứng dụng của nó đã trở thành yêu cầu bắt buộc trong các dự án BIM hiện nay. File IFC giúp thống nhất cấu trúc dữ liệu giữa các bên tham gia dự án, hạn chế sai lệch thông tin và giảm rủi ro trong quá trình thiết kế - thi công. Đầu tư vào việc sử dụng file IFC hiệu quả chính là chìa khóa để đảm bảo tiến độ, chất lượng và chi phí dự án được kiểm soát tối ưu.
Để làm việc mượt mà với dữ liệu BIM và đảm bảo hệ thống vận hành ổn định, bạn nên trang bị một chiếc laptop văn phòng cấu hình mạnh. Truy cập FPT Shop ngay hôm nay để chọn lựa laptop chính hãng, nhận ưu đãi hấp dẫn và hỗ trợ trả góp, giúp bạn an tâm trong công việc và học tập.
Xem thêm:
:quality(75)/estore-v2/img/fptshop-logo.png)
:quality(75)/bao_tri_la_gi_0_202e2ff119.jpg)
:quality(75)/he_thong_chong_set_1_8f6e6a039e.jpg)
:quality(75)/dieu_hoa_vrv_la_gi_93ec2447cb.jpg)
:quality(75)/revit_mep_0_4c5cf64dbf.png)
:quality(75)/logia_la_gi_1_71e703e79e.jpg)